- Drum Rudiments
Drum rudiments are the building blocks of drumming. They are a series of standardized patterns that drummers use to develop their technique. Fills often incorporate drum rudiments, such as the paradiddle, the flam, and the ratamacue.
- Cymbal Chokes
Cymbal chokes are a technique that drummers use to create a short, staccato sound on the cymbals. This can be done by grabbing the cymbal with the hand and muting it, or by using a drumstick to strike the cymbal and then quickly muting it with the hand.
- Ghost Notes
Ghost notes are very quiet notes that are played between the main beats of the song. They are often used to create a sense of syncopation and groove. Ghost notes can be played on the snare drum, the toms, or the cymbals.
- Polyrhythms
Polyrhythms are two or more rhythms that are played simultaneously. They can be used to create a sense of complexity and interest in the music. Fills often incorporate polyrhythms, such as playing a triplet rhythm over a 4/4 beat.
